BetterBoard is built around the keyboard. Every action lives one keystroke away in ⌘K, the basics are single keys, and bulk-editing a dozen work items reuses the same shortcuts as editing one. Move between cards, columns, and boards without ever reaching for the mouse.
Press ⌘K and start typing. Every action in the app sits behind the same prompt, and the palette is context-aware — it only ever shows what makes sense for whatever you've got selected.
The actions you do dozens of times a day are bound to single keys, not chord combinations. Assign, label, flag, edit, create — learn them once and your hands stop leaving the home row.
Shift-arrow to grab a range, space to toggle anything in or out, then run the same shortcut you'd use on a single card — and watch it apply to the whole set. No separate bulk-edit dialog, no page reload, no waiting.
Up and down step between cards in a column. Left and right jump to the next column. Enter opens the focused card, Esc closes it. The whole board is a keyboard surface — the mouse becomes a backup, not a requirement.

BetterBoard runs on Atlassian Forge — Atlassian's official platform for hosted Marketplace apps. That means it installs from the Marketplace in seconds, lives entirely inside your Atlassian Cloud tenant, and inherits every Jira permission your team already has. Your data stays where it always has. Nothing new to host, nothing new to configure.
